Build your website
CUPE hosts websites at no cost for locals.
• WordPress software
• Pre-built basic site with CUPE logos and images
• Pages and features already set up for you
Just choose a sample site. Once it’s created, you can organize
and add to it. Support is an email away at comm@cupe.ca.
To get started, visit cupe.ca/webhosting.

Send better email
MailChimp is easy-to-use software with options for
designing, sending and saving emails.
Special features
• Predesigned templates
• Drag and drop photos and content blocks
• Testing and preview for mobile devices
• Works well on mobile devices
Learn more at mailchimp.com or drop us a line at
comm@cupe.ca.

  • #8 Growing your local’s email list is a top communications priority. Emails can contain a lot of information, and members can save them to read anytime. You can also track the success of your email campaigns and content. We can also integrate Mailchimp with your local’s Wordpress site.
  • #12 The Canadian Association of Labour Media provides training, news and online services to a network of union activists and editors. It’s a great source of graphics and content for local publications.
